Why AI Chatbots Have Become a Core Business Growth Tool
Several trends pushed AI chatbots into mainstream business operations.
First, customer expectations changed dramatically. People want immediate answers regardless of time zone or business hours. Whether someone is shopping for skincare products, comparing SaaS subscriptions, or booking a demo for enterprise software, delays reduce conversion probability.
Second, advances in large language models and natural language processing made chatbot interactions feel more human. Earlier bots relied heavily on scripted decision trees. Modern conversational AI systems can understand intent, context, product questions, and even nuanced buying signals.
Third, businesses realized that website traffic alone doesnโt guarantee revenue. Many sites lose potential customers because visitors leave with unanswered questions.
An AI sales chatbot helps bridge that gap.
Instead of forcing users to search through menus, knowledge bases, or FAQ pages, the chatbot guides them toward answers instantly.
That changes user behavior in several ways:
- Reduced bounce rates
- Longer session duration
- Higher engagement depth
- Faster decision-making
- Better lead qualification
- More completed purchases
For businesses spending heavily on paid acquisition channels like Google Ads, Meta Ads, LinkedIn Ads, and programmatic advertising, improving onsite conversion rates can dramatically improve return on ad spend.

How AI Chatbots Increase Conversions Across the Customer Journey
Conversion optimization isnโt a single moment. Itโs a sequence of interactions.
AI chatbots influence multiple stages of the funnel simultaneously.
Lead Capture Without Friction
Traditional lead forms create resistance.
Visitors often hesitate to fill out long forms because theyโre unsure whether the offer is relevant. A conversational chatbot changes the interaction dynamic.
Instead of presenting a static form, the chatbot asks natural questions:
- What are you looking for?
- What size is your business?
- What problem are you trying to solve?
- Whatโs your budget range?
This conversational approach feels more interactive and less transactional.
Businesses frequently see higher lead completion rates because users perceive the interaction as helpful rather than intrusive.
For B2B SaaS companies, this is especially valuable because chatbot automation can pre-qualify leads before routing them to sales representatives.
That reduces wasted sales calls and improves pipeline quality.

Abandoned Cart Recovery in Real Time
Cart abandonment remains a major ecommerce challenge.
Many customers leave during checkout because of:
- Shipping uncertainty
- Product hesitation
- Pricing concerns
- Technical confusion
- Last-minute objections
AI sales chatbots can intervene before the customer exits.
For instance:
- Offering shipping clarification
- Recommending alternative payment options
- Explaining return policies
- Providing discount eligibility
- Answering compatibility questions
Some chatbots also trigger follow-up sequences through email, SMS, or retargeting workflows connected to ecommerce automation systems.
This creates a multi-channel recovery strategy instead of relying solely on abandoned cart emails.

AI Sales Chatbots vs Traditional Live Chat
Many businesses still rely on conventional live chat systems.
While live chat remains useful, AI chatbots introduce several operational advantages.
| Feature | Traditional Live Chat | AI Sales Chatbot |
|---|---|---|
| Availability | Limited by staffing | 24/7 |
| Scalability | Agent dependent | Highly scalable |
| Response Speed | Variable | Instant |
| Qualification | Manual | Automated |
| Personalization | Agent skill dependent | AI-driven |
| Cost Efficiency | Higher staffing costs | Lower operational scaling costs |
| Analytics | Basic | Advanced intent tracking |
That said, the best systems often combine both approaches.
AI handles repetitive interactions while humans manage high-complexity conversations.
Hybrid conversational models generally produce the best customer experience.

Real-World Chatbot Conversion Workflows
Understanding practical workflows helps businesses visualize implementation strategies.
Ecommerce Workflow Example
- Visitor lands on product page
- Chatbot asks if assistance is needed
- User asks about sizing
- Chatbot recommends appropriate size
- User expresses concern about returns
- Chatbot explains return policy
- Customer adds product to cart
- Chatbot suggests complementary item
- Purchase completed
This single interaction can increase:
- Conversion likelihood
- Average order value
- Customer confidence
SaaS Lead Qualification Workflow
- Visitor arrives from Google Ads
- Chatbot asks about business goals
- User explains operational challenge
- Chatbot identifies appropriate solution category
- AI qualifies company size and budget
- Demo offered automatically
- CRM updated with conversation insights
- Sales rep receives high-intent lead
This reduces friction while improving sales efficiency.

Measuring Chatbot Conversion Performance
Businesses often deploy chatbots without defining success metrics.
Thatโs a mistake.
Key performance indicators should include both operational and revenue-focused metrics.
Core Metrics
Conversion Rate Impact
How many chatbot users convert compared to non-chatbot users?
Lead Qualification Rate
How many conversations produce sales-qualified leads?
Customer Satisfaction
How do users rate chatbot interactions?
Response Time
Instant responsiveness is one of the biggest advantages of AI chatbots.
Average Order Value
Do chatbot-assisted customers spend more?
Cart Recovery Rate
How many abandoned carts are recovered?
Support Ticket Reduction
How much workload shifts away from human support agents?
